1. What is the primary purpose of fall protection?
A. Increase productivity on job sites
B. Prevent workers from falling from elevated surfaces
C. Reduce equipment costs
D. Improve communication between workers
Rationale: Fall protection systems are designed to eliminate or
minimize injury from falls.
Correct Answer: B
2. At what height is fall protection generally required in
construction?
A. 3 feet
B. 4 feet
C. 6 feet
D. 10 feet
Rationale: OSHA commonly requires fall protection at 6 feet in
construction settings.
Correct Answer: C

,6. What is the maximum free fall distance allowed by OSHA
for a fall arrest system?
A. 2 feet
B. 4 feet
C. 6 feet
D. 10 feet
Rationale: OSHA limits free fall distance to 6 feet in most cases.
Correct Answer: C
7. Which component connects a harness to an anchorage
point?
A. Lanyard
B. Scaffolding
C. Guardrail
D. Ladder
Rationale: Lanyards or lifelines connect harnesses to anchors.
Correct Answer: A
8. What is the minimum strength requirement for a personal
fall arrest anchorage point?
A. 1,000 lbs
B. 2,000 lbs
C. 3,000 lbs
, D. 5,000 lbs per worker
Rationale: OSHA requires anchorage strength of at least 5,000
lbs per worker.
Correct Answer: D
